John Nelson Darby visited this exclusive assembly in the 1870's in Lowell, Kent, Grand Rapids metro, [[Michigan]], hosted by Dr. C. Wunch. Jerry Wunch, a grandson, remembers stories of his father sitting on JND's lap as a child during this visit. It John Blaak of Grand Rapids was likely there as this meeting too.  The assembly met from +1878-1889+, possibly also meeting part of the time in Saranac in nearby Ionia Co. After 1884, it would be known as TW-Lowe.
In 1899, some (including Jerry's parents) started a Grant meeting on College Ave., Grand Rapids that in 1925 split, with some starting a new meeting on Johannes Street, that reunited with the KLC's in the early 1970's. The majority joined with the opens at this time, and eventually became what is now [Forhttps://fhbc.church Forest Hills Bible Chapel]]. Jerry was a longtime missionary to New Guinea, honored by their government for his standards in beekeeping.
